Woods Mill update, June 2026

, 23 June 2026
Woods Mill update, June 2026
Woods Mill meadow © Ellie Mitchelson

Ryan Allison

Area Manager - West 

Woods Mill is a much-loved reserve. Many people, including our Trustees, have been regular visitors since childhood, and care very much about it.

As with all of our reserves, Woods Mill has a regularly reviewed, deeply-considered Management Plan. And both our reserves team, and our incredible Friday Conservation Volunteers, are involved with implementing those plans. We will be keeping you up-to-date about some particularly interesting aspects of this, but, in the meantime, we wanted to address the immediate concerns of some visitors, who are worried about the Woods Mill pond. This is a body of water which has, undoubtedly, changed over the decades. Not suddenly, or dramatically, but gradually. 

Broad-bodied Chaser on Woods Mill pond © Kai Hilton

Woods Mill pond is an artificial waterbody, dammed at its lower end, and the summer water flow into the pond has been reduced since the stream that once fed it was restored to its former natural path in 2010 and the leat has largely been disconnected from the Woods Mill stream (something which is outside of our control). When a water body is dammed by hard engineering, it collects silt, as its natural functions are reduced/removed. Without dredging, this builds up over time. 

As the silt builds, there is less space for water. So, the water depth reduces. As the water depth reduces, the water is warmed faster. Warm water carries less oxygen. Duckweed and floating lilies thrive in these conditions, which is what visitors are noticing. All of this is, of course, exacerbated by the droughts we have been experiencing in recent years.

Sussex Wildlife Trust is considering whether desilting is an option, but this option is both very costly and problematic in other ways. The alternative is becoming comfortable with natural succession. Over time, the pond would slowly reduce and transition into more reed-swamp and shallow water. We appreciate this would mean change, and change isn't easy, especially if you have happy memories of a place looking a certain way. 

Grey Heron at Woods Mill © Kai Hilton

In the meantime, the West Nature Reserves Team, including the Friday Volunteer Reserve Management group, has begun opening up the area around the pond to allow more air to flow over the water surface to aid getting oxygen into the warm, shallow water. We have been tree and shrub felling. This work will continue during autumn and winter. The Ranger team will manually remove some areas of floating lilies and sweep off some duckweed, which will result in some open water, but this will be only be effective for a short while.

Woods Mill Nature Reserve is more than a pond. It has many beautiful areas to visit, including ancient woodlands, meadows and flood plains, all of which support a huge variety of wildlife. The Friday Volunteers, for example, have recently widened one of the woodland paths to make it a hotspot for butterflies. 

Marbled White © Darin Smith

We are aware visitors miss the bird hide, so please be reassured that plans are in place for a bird hide to return to the reserve.

It's also important to note the many wildlife successes at Woods Mill. For example, Coots have bred in the pond this year, as have Moorhen, and at least one family of Mallard is currently on eggs. Little Grebe have been nesting, and Grey Heron are on the reserve most days. We've heard two singing male Nightingale, so likely there are two nests. And Cuckoo have been calling regularly for over a month.

We will continue to keep you up to date with future plans for Woods Mill Nature Reserve.

Leave a comment

Comments

  • Lynne:

    I look forward to seeing the narural progression. As a regular visitor it is fascinating to observe change.

    24 Jun 2026 09:26:00

  • Val Bentley:

    I remember that the Lake was drained 15 (?) years ago, when all the carp were removed and lots of silt taken out. It was pretty dead before that – apart from the carp! I think someone gave them some money to do it as it must have cost a bit but looked fabulous afterwards. Would be nice to see it restored again as there isn’t much in the way of freshwater lakes in the vicinity, At least not open to public access.

    24 Jun 2026 15:53:00

Time Δ Debug Message - Perch Runway 3.2
1782401305.67280 [906] SELECT p.pagePath, pr.routePattern, pr.routeRegExp, p.pageTemplate, pr.routeOrder, s.settingValue AS siteOffline FROM swt_pages_staging p LEFT JOIN swt_page_routes pr ON p.pageID=pr.pageID LEFT JOIN swt_settings s ON s.settingID='siteOffline' UNION SELECT NULL AS pagePath, pr2.routePattern, pr2.routeRegExp, pr2.templatePath AS pageTemplate, pr2.routeOrder, NULL AS siteOffline FROM swt_page_routes pr2 WHERE templateID!=0 ORDER BY routeOrder ASC, pagePath ASC
1782401305.70490.0321Matched route: news/[slug:s]
1782401305.70510.0002Server address: 216.73.217.95
1782401305.70510Using master page: /templates/pages/blog/post.php
1782401305.70510Page arguments:
Array
(
    [0] => /news/woods-mill-update-june-2026
    [s] => woods-mill-update-june-2026
    [1] => woods-mill-update-june-2026
)
1782401305.70540.0003 [1] SELECT * FROM swt_pages_staging WHERE pagePath='/news/post' LIMIT 1
1782401305.70660.0012 [86] SELECT DISTINCT settingID, settingValue FROM swt_settings WHERE userID=0
1782401305.70850.0019 [1] SELECT locationID FROM swt_shop_tax_locations WHERE locationIsHome=1 LIMIT 1
1782401305.70910.0006INSERT INTO swt_shop_cart(memberID,locationID,currencyID,cartPricing,cartProperties) VALUES(NULL,'1',47,'standard','[]')
1782401305.7110.002 [1] SELECT * FROM swt_shop_cart WHERE cartID=22274140
1782401305.71160.0006 [1] SELECT * FROM swt_shop_cart WHERE cartID=22274140
1782401305.71210.0005 [nil] SELECT * FROM swt_shop_sales WHERE saleFrom<='2026-06-25 15:28:00' AND saleTo>'2026-06-25 15:28:00' AND saleActive=1 AND saleDeleted IS NULL ORDER BY saleOrder ASC
1782401305.71330.0012 [1] SELECT SQL_CALC_FOUND_ROWS DISTINCT tbl.* FROM ( SELECT idx.itemID, main.*, idx2.indexValue as sortval FROM swt_blog_index idx JOIN swt_blog_posts main ON idx.itemID=main.postID AND idx.itemKey='postID' JOIN swt_blog_index idx2 ON idx.itemID=idx2.itemID AND idx.itemKey='postID' AND idx2.indexKey='_id' WHERE 1=1 AND ((idx.indexKey='postSlug' AND idx.indexValue='woods-mill-update-june-2026')) AND idx.itemID=idx2.itemID AND idx.itemKey=idx2.itemKey GROUP BY idx.itemID, idx2.indexValue, postID ) as tbl WHERE (postStatus='Published' AND postDateTime<='2026-06-25 15:28:00' ) GROUP BY itemID, sortval ORDER BY sortval ASC LIMIT 0, 10
1782401305.7160.0027 [1] SELECT FOUND_ROWS() AS `count`
1782401305.71660.0006 [1] SELECT * FROM swt_blog_posts WHERE postID=3959 AND postStatus='Published' AND postDateTime<='2026-06-25 15:28:00'
1782401305.71760.0009 [13] SELECT * FROM swt_blog_sections ORDER BY sectionTitle ASC
1782401305.71840.0008 [1] SELECT * FROM swt_blogs ORDER BY blogTitle ASC
1782401305.71910.0007 [1] SELECT * FROM swt_categories WHERE catID=79 LIMIT 1
1782401305.71960.0005 [1] SELECT * FROM swt_categories WHERE catID=36 LIMIT 1
1782401305.72010.0005Using template: /templates/blog/post.html
1782401305.72030.0002 [162] SELECT catID, catPath FROM swt_categories
1782401305.72110.0008 [1] SELECT * FROM swt_blog_posts WHERE postStatus='Published' AND postDateTime<='2026-06-25 15:28:00' AND postSlug='woods-mill-update-june-2026'
1782401305.7480.027Using template: /templates/blog/post.html
1782401305.74850.0005 [250] SELECT country, countryID FROM swt_shop_countries WHERE countryActive=1 ORDER BY country ASC
1782401305.75050.002Using template: /templates/pages/attributes/seo.html
1782401305.75070.0002 [1] SELECT regionID, regionTemplate, regionPage, regionRev AS rev FROM swt_content_regions WHERE regionKey='Banner image' AND (regionPage='/news/post' OR regionPage='*')
1782401305.75170.001 [nil] SELECT * FROM ( SELECT idx.itemID, c.regionID, idx.pageID, c.itemJSON, idx2.indexValue as sortval FROM swt_content_index idx JOIN swt_content_items c ON idx.itemID=c.itemID AND idx.itemRev=c.itemRev AND idx.regionID=c.regionID JOIN swt_content_index idx2 ON idx.itemID=idx2.itemID AND idx.itemRev=idx2.itemRev AND idx2.indexKey='_order' WHERE ((idx.regionID=104 AND idx.itemRev=0)) AND idx.itemID=idx2.itemID AND idx.itemRev=idx2.itemRev ) as tbl GROUP BY itemID, pageID, itemJSON, sortval, regionID ORDER BY sortval ASC
1782401305.75340.0016 [82] SELECT * FROM swt_pages_staging WHERE pageNew=0 AND pageHidden=0 AND pageDepth >=0 AND pageDepth<=2 ORDER BY pageTreePosition ASC
1782401305.7560.0026 [1] SELECT pageTreePosition FROM swt_pages_staging WHERE pagePath='/news/post' LIMIT 1
1782401305.75650.0005 [2] SELECT pageID FROM swt_pages_staging WHERE pageTreePosition IN ('000-006-001', '000-006', '000') ORDER BY pageTreePosition DESC
1782401305.75850.002Using template: /templates/navigation/ps_nav_template.html
1782401305.75860 [6] Using template: /templates/navigation/ps_nav_template_children.html
1782401305.75940.0008 [4] Using template: /templates/navigation/ps_nav_template_children.html
1782401305.75990.0005 [29] Using template: /templates/navigation/ps_nav_template_children.html
1782401305.76260.0027 [10] Using template: /templates/navigation/ps_nav_template_children.html
1782401305.76360.001 [7] Using template: /templates/navigation/ps_nav_template_children.html
1782401305.76430.0007 [9] Using template: /templates/navigation/ps_nav_template_children.html
1782401305.76670.0024 [1] SELECT pageTreePosition FROM swt_pages_staging WHERE pagePath='/news/post' OR pageSortPath='/news/post' LIMIT 1
1782401305.77020.0035 [1] SELECT * FROM swt_pages_staging WHERE pageHidden=0 AND pageNew=0 AND pageTreePosition IN ('000-006-001', '000-006', '000') ORDER BY pageTreePosition
1782401305.77250.0022 [1] Using template: /templates/navigation/breadcrumbs.html
1782401305.77290.0005Using template: /templates/blog/post.html
1782401305.77320.0003 [1] SELECT * FROM swt_blog_authors WHERE authorID='1' LIMIT 1
1782401305.77770.0045Using template: /templates/blog/author.html
1782401305.77810.0005 [1] SELECT SQL_CALC_FOUND_ROWS DISTINCT tbl.* FROM ( SELECT idx.itemID, main.*, idx2.indexValue as sortval FROM swt_blog_index idx JOIN swt_blog_posts main ON idx.itemID=main.postID AND idx.itemKey='postID' JOIN swt_blog_index idx2 ON idx.itemID=idx2.itemID AND idx.itemKey='postID' AND idx2.indexKey='_id' WHERE 1=1 AND ((idx.indexKey='postSlug' AND idx.indexValue='woods-mill-update-june-2026')) AND idx.itemID=idx2.itemID AND idx.itemKey=idx2.itemKey GROUP BY idx.itemID, idx2.indexValue, postID ) as tbl WHERE (postStatus='Published' AND postDateTime<='2026-06-25 15:28:00' ) GROUP BY itemID, sortval ORDER BY sortval ASC LIMIT 0, 1
1782401305.78020.002 [1] SELECT FOUND_ROWS() AS `count`
1782401305.78060.0004 [1] Using template: /templates/blog/post.html
1782401305.78370.0031Using template: /templates/blog/comment_form.html
1782401305.78460.0009 [2] SELECT * FROM swt_blog_comments WHERE 1=1 AND postID=3959 AND commentStatus='LIVE' ORDER BY FIELD(webmentionType, 'like', 'repost', 'comment', NULL) ASC, commentDateTime ASC
1782401305.8330.0484 [2] Using template: /templates/blog/comment.html
1782401305.83370.0007Using template: /templates/blog/post.html
1782401305.83380.0001 [1] SELECT * FROM swt_blog_authors WHERE authorID='1' LIMIT 1
1782401305.83470.0009 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pagePath='/what-we-do' OR pageSortPath='/what-we-do' LIMIT 1
1782401305.83520.0006 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pageTreePosition='000-002' LIMIT 1
1782401305.83580.0006 [7] SELECT * FROM swt_pages_staging WHERE pageNew=0 AND pageHidden=0 AND pageTreePosition LIKE '000-002%' AND pageDepth >=1 AND pageDepth<=2 ORDER BY pageTreePosition ASC
1782401305.83790.0021 [1] SELECT pageTreePosition FROM swt_pages_staging WHERE pagePath='/news/post' LIMIT 1
1782401305.83850.0005 [2] SELECT pageID FROM swt_pages_staging WHERE pageTreePosition IN ('000-006-001', '000-006', '000') ORDER BY pageTreePosition DESC
1782401305.84020.0017 [6] Using template: /templates/navigation/footer-nav.html
1782401305.84140.0012 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pagePath='/make-a-difference' OR pageSortPath='/make-a-difference' LIMIT 1
1782401305.8420.0006 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pageTreePosition='000-005' LIMIT 1
1782401305.84250.0005 [38] SELECT * FROM swt_pages_staging WHERE pageNew=0 AND pageHidden=0 AND pageTreePosition LIKE '000-005%' ORDER BY pageTreePosition ASC
1782401305.84470.0022 [1] SELECT pageTreePosition FROM swt_pages_staging WHERE pagePath='/news/post' LIMIT 1
1782401305.84510.0005 [2] SELECT pageID FROM swt_pages_staging WHERE pageTreePosition IN ('000-006-001', '000-006', '000') ORDER BY pageTreePosition DESC
1782401305.8470.0019 [10] Using template: /templates/navigation/footer-nav.html
1782401305.84890.002 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pagePath='/visit' OR pageSortPath='/visit' LIMIT 1
1782401305.84950.0006 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pageTreePosition='000-004' LIMIT 1
1782401305.85010.0006 [30] SELECT * FROM swt_pages_staging WHERE pageNew=0 AND pageHidden=0 AND pageTreePosition LIKE '000-004%' AND pageDepth >=1 AND pageDepth<=2 ORDER BY pageTreePosition ASC
1782401305.85280.0027 [1] SELECT pageTreePosition FROM swt_pages_staging WHERE pagePath='/news/post' LIMIT 1
1782401305.85330.0005 [2] SELECT pageID FROM swt_pages_staging WHERE pageTreePosition IN ('000-006-001', '000-006', '000') ORDER BY pageTreePosition DESC
1782401305.85580.0024 [29] Using template: /templates/navigation/footer-nav.html
1782401305.85780.002 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pagePath='/make-a-difference' OR pageSortPath='/make-a-difference' LIMIT 1
1782401305.85840.0007 [1] SELECT pageID, pageParentID, pageDepth, pageTreePosition FROM swt_pages_staging WHERE pageTreePosition='000-005' LIMIT 1
1782401305.85890.0005 [11] SELECT * FROM swt_pages_staging WHERE pageNew=0 AND pageHidden=0 AND pageTreePosition LIKE '000-005%' AND pageDepth >=1 AND pageDepth<=2 ORDER BY pageTreePosition ASC
1782401305.86160.0026 [1] SELECT pageTreePosition FROM swt_pages_staging WHERE pagePath='/news/post' LIMIT 1
1782401305.86210.0005 [2] SELECT pageID FROM swt_pages_staging WHERE pageTreePosition IN ('000-006-001', '000-006', '000') ORDER BY pageTreePosition DESC
1782401305.86420.0021 [10] Using template: /templates/navigation/footer-nav.html
1782401305.86560.0015Request time: 0.1962
1782401305.86570Process time: 0.196
1782401305.86570Memory: 1.652